
The Woodbury Veterans of Foreign Wars (VFW) Post 9024 and the Woodbury American Legion Post 501 hosted the first ever Joint Annual Awards banquet on February 21, 2019 at the Green Mill Restaurant in Woodbury. The awards were hosted by VFW Post 9024 Commander, Paul Lindahl and American Legion Post 501 Commander, Tom Grezek.
The two groups presented the following awards.
Veterans Service Awards – Thallassa Gunelius, Eligibility Specialist Veterans Service Division and Ryan Carufel, Washington Count Veterans Service Officer
Public Safety Awards – Police Officer Detective Lynn Lund, Firefighter Fire Lieutenant Kevin Priester, Emergency Medical Technician, Ronald Hawkins
Patriot’s Pen Awards for Sixth to Eighth grade essays on “Why I honor the American Flag”
1st Place – Harish Premsai, Woodbury Middle School
2nd Place – Anthony Baston, Woodbury Middle School
3rd Place (tie) – Charles Jacobson and Yifan Zhai, Woodbury Middle School
Voice of Democracy Awards for Ninth to Twelfth grade students - This is an annual VFW nationwide scholarship program. This year’s oral presentations were on “Why my Vote Matters”.
1st Place – Quinn Bruning, Woodbury High School
2nd Place – Kathryn Garvin, Woodbury High School
3rd Place – Katherine Yapp, Math and Science Academy.
